Output f9138fa1372cfbf7e2fce2237572df4428d020a6a26a50e920857ffaa2833896:12

value
25010366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434de94cb8ee766d77fc1f390a1cb1b5f393cd99 OP_EQUAL
address
ME32qf3UYZbLqREDBZXchd7c6hF32849hK
transaction
f9138fa1372cfbf7e2fce2237572df4428d020a6a26a50e920857ffaa2833896
spent
true